RCIA
RCIA is the process by which the Church prepares adults to be fully initiated in the Catholic faith.  Learn more.

Circle Of Saint Bede

Circle of St. Bede
Faculty and professionals seek to promote the integration of faith with our academic lives and to foster a sense of Catholic community in the campus setting. Find out more.
